PSA Software Implementation: A Guide and Common Challenges You Need to Know


Nexa Lab Blog – Professional Services Automation (PSA) software is becoming an integral tool for businesses aiming to optimise their operational efficiency.

Using technology such as PSA is not only advantageous but also necessary, when the market environment is fast-paced. This kind of software makes it easier to manage complex business activities by streamlining a variety of business processes, including resource allocation, project management, billing, and time tracking.

Today, we will discuss the implementation of PSA software, covering general implementation guidelines and common challenges that you should be aware of.

So let’s get started without further ado!

Why is Proper PSA Implementation Crucial for Your Business?

Enhancing Operational Efficiency

Proper implementation of PSA software significantly enhances operational efficiency. It integrates different functional areas of a business, allowing seamless communication and data flow between departments. This integration reduces time spent on manual data entry and cross-checking information, speeding up project timelines and reducing the likelihood of errors.

Improved Resource Management

PSA tools offer sophisticated resource management features that help businesses optimize the use of their workforce. By providing real-time visibility into each team member’s workload and availability, PSA software enables managers to allocate resources more effectively, which is crucial for maintaining high productivity levels without overworking employees.

Financial Transparency and Control

One of the major benefits of PSA software is improved financial management. It provides detailed insights into project budgets, costs, and profitability, helping businesses make informed financial decisions. Effective implementation ensures that every billable hour is tracked and billed correctly, improving cash flow and reducing revenue leakage.


As businesses grow, their operations become more complex. PSA software is designed to scale with your business, accommodating new users, larger projects, and more complex business models. Proper implementation means setting up the software in a way that supports growth without significant additional investments in new systems.

The benefits of PSA software implementation can be realised at different business scales and models, as we have seen as we have examined its crucial elements and challenges. Using PSA software can be a game-changing tactic for small businesses in particular to increase productivity and scalability without breaking the bank.

To go deeper into how smaller enterprises can leverage PSA tools to their advantage, we invite you to read our detailed analysis on this topic.

We invite you to read our guiide on this subject to learn more about how smaller businesses can benefit from PSA tools.

Learn More: How Small Businesses Can Benefit from PSA Software

Guide for Successful PSA Software Implementation

Implementing PSA software successfully requires a structured approach. Here are the steps to ensure a smooth and effective implementation, according to LinkedIn Pulse:

Step 1: Define Your Objectives

Before implementing any new software, it’s crucial to define what you want to achieve. Set clear, measurable objectives for what the PSA system needs to accomplish. This might include specific improvements in project delivery times, resource utilisation rates, or billing accuracy.

Step 2: Choose the Right Software

Select a PSA solution that fits well with your business’s size, complexity, and industry. Consider features, scalability, user-friendliness, and integration capabilities with existing systems. Don’t forget to involve end-users in the selection process since their buy-in is essential for successful adoption.

Step 3: Plan Your Implementation

Develop a detailed implementation plan that includes timelines, responsibilities, and the resources needed. This plan should outline how and when each part of the system will be rolled out. Consider a phased approach to reduce disruption to your business operations.

Step 4: Train Your Team

Comprehensive training is crucial for ensuring that your team can use the new system effectively. Provide training sessions that cover both the technical aspects of the software and how it fits into your business processes.

Step 5: Monitor and Adjust

After the PSA software goes live, continuously monitor its performance and the achievement of business objectives. Be prepared to make adjustments based on user feedback and changing business needs. This iterative process helps refine the system to better support your operations.

Common Challenges You May Face During PSA Software Implementation

Implementing Professional Services Automation (PSA) software often involves overcoming several common challenges that can affect the success and efficiency of the process.

One primary issue is the process automation implementation.

While PSA software is capable of automating many manual tasks critical to onboarding new service projects, achieving this requires careful planning and seamless integration with existing systems.

Another significant challenge is ensuring data confidence and accessibility.

PSA software consolidates various metrics and data sources into a single, real-time platform. However, ensuring the accuracy and easy access to this data can be a complex task that demands meticulous attention to detail.

Furthermore, the implementation process itself can be challenging. Without a detailed and systematic plan, organisations risk critical data loss and widespread confusion among employees, which can severely hinder the adoption process.

The time it takes for users to adopt the new system is another aspect that organisations often underestimate. Effective training and clear communication are essential to facilitate this transition and to ensure that all team members are comfortable and proficient with the new system.

For that reason, standardising business processes prior to software implementation is important.

This standardisation helps ensure that project management is efficient and consistent, preventing confusion and the mishandling of deadlines and services. Standardised business processes make the implementation of PSA software much easier and more successful, particularly in terms of team adaptation.

The complexity of PSA software implementation makes it vital to choose the best system for your needs as a business. How successfully your company deploys and uses these automation tools can be greatly impacted by the software selection.

For guidance on identifying the most crucial features and performing a thorough assessment before making your decision, consider exploring our comprehensive guide.

To find out how to determine the most important features and conduct a thorough evaluation prior to choosing, take a look at our extensive guide.

Learn More: How to Choose Professional Services Automation Software: Key Features and Assessment You Need to Do


PSA software implementation is critical for any business looking to improve operational efficiency and profitability. You can ensure that your PSA system fully supports your operational goals by following a structured implementation guide and continuously adapting to your company’s requirements.

However, PSA software alone sometimes … isn’t enough.

Combining PSA software with CRM tools can help Manage Service Provider (MSPs) businesses effectively manage client interactions, track sales opportunities, and provide personalised services to clients, ultimately leading to increased customer satisfaction and loyalty.

Integrate your PSA software and CRM solutions with Nexalab App Fusion!

Nexalab App Fusion is a comprehensive integration platform that easily connects your choice of monitoring tools with PSA software like Datto Autotask and other critical tools such as CRM software like Hubspot to optimise your troubleshooting processes and improve overall service delivery.

With App Fusion, you can easily streamline your workflows, automate repetitive tasks, and gain valuable insights into your operations to make data-driven decisions for your MSP business.

Leave a Reply

Your email address will not be published. Required fields are marked *